Life Science is a podcast for people who love asking, "I wonder why..." Each episode, we'll tackle a fascinating question about science, history, psychology, nature, pop culture, or everyday life—separating fact from fiction through trusted research and lively conversation. You'll leave every episode having learned something new, seeing the world a little differently, and possibly with a few more questions of your own. If you're endlessly curious and enjoy learning and having the best water cooler conversation starters, Life Science is for you.

    Why are Cheerios shaped like O’s, and why do they huddle together in your bowl? Jess and Bryan start with the surprisingly scientific story behind a breakfast classic, then follow the evidence from cholera and how beer helped identify how it was spread to radioactive health tonics ('nuf said). It’s a conversation about the morning menu and what happens when science changes its mind.
